Deconstructing the Green Goodness: The Ingredient List
The first step in understanding Trader Joe’s Green Goddess seasoning is to examine its ingredient list. Unveiling the components provides insight into the flavor combinations and allows consumers to make informed decisions based on their dietary needs and preferences.
The primary players in this green powerhouse are dried herbs. Parsley, chives, garlic, onion, and lemon peel form the foundation of the seasoning’s aromatic and savory profile. Each herb contributes its unique characteristics: Parsley offers a fresh, slightly peppery note; chives deliver a mild oniony flavor; garlic and onion provide depth and umami; and lemon peel adds a bright, citrusy zest.
Beyond the core herbs, the seasoning also includes salt, spices, and other flavor enhancers. Salt is, of course, essential for enhancing the overall flavor and acting as a preservative. The specific spices used in the blend are often proprietary, but a closer look reveals hints of black pepper and possibly other complementary spices that contribute to the seasoning’s complexity.
Maltodextrin is another ingredient often found in seasoning blends, and it serves multiple purposes. It acts as a carrier for the flavors, helps to prevent clumping, and can add a subtle sweetness. However, it’s important to note that maltodextrin is a carbohydrate derived from corn, rice, or potatoes, which may be a consideration for individuals following specific diets, such as keto or low-carb.
Citric acid is another key ingredient. It is a natural acid found in citrus fruits and is used to enhance the lemon flavor and provide a tangy kick. It also acts as a preservative, helping to extend the shelf life of the seasoning.
Lastly, it’s worth noting that Trader Joe’s Green Goddess seasoning is typically free of artificial colors, flavors, and preservatives, making it a relatively clean and natural option compared to some other commercially available seasoning blends.

Unleashing the Culinary Potential: Ways to Use Green Goddess Seasoning
The versatility of Trader Joe’s Green Goddess seasoning is one of its most appealing qualities. It can be used in countless ways to add a burst of flavor to your cooking.
One of the most popular uses is as a seasoning for vegetables. Sprinkle it on roasted vegetables like broccoli, asparagus, or Brussels sprouts for a quick and easy way to enhance their flavor. It also works well on grilled vegetables, adding a fresh and zesty note.
The seasoning is also excellent for seasoning proteins. Use it as a rub for chicken, fish, or tofu before grilling, baking, or pan-frying. It adds a delicious herbaceous flavor that complements the protein without overpowering it.
Beyond vegetables and proteins, the Green Goddess seasoning can also be used in sauces, dressings, and dips. Add it to your favorite vinaigrette for a zesty twist, or sprinkle it into sour cream or yogurt to create a flavorful dip for vegetables or chips.

Green Goddess Alternatives: Homemade Blends and Similar Products
While Trader Joe’s Green Goddess seasoning is a convenient and delicious option, there are also other alternatives available. For those who enjoy DIY projects, creating a homemade version allows for customization of the ingredients and flavor profile. Several copycat recipes can be found online, offering variations on the original blend.
These homemade versions typically involve combining dried parsley, chives, garlic powder, onion powder, lemon peel, salt, pepper, and possibly other herbs and spices to taste. The proportions can be adjusted to suit individual preferences. Making your own blend also allows you to control the sodium content and avoid any unwanted additives.

How does Trader Joe’s Green Goddess Seasoning differ from traditional Green Goddess dressing?
Traditional Green Goddess dressing is a creamy sauce typically made with mayonnaise, sour cream, or yogurt, combined with herbs like parsley, chives, tarragon, and lemon juice. It often includes anchovies for a savory umami flavor. The Trader Joe’s Green Goddess Seasoning attempts to replicate this flavor profile in a dry, shelf-stable form.
The seasoning achieves this by using dried versions of the herbs found in the dressing, along with dried onion, garlic, and lemon peel. While it captures the herbaceous and citrusy notes, it lacks the creamy texture and tangy base of the original dressing. Think of it as a convenient way to add the essence of Green Goddess to dishes without the need for a wet dressing.

What is the shelf life of Trader Joe’s Green Goddess Seasoning?
Trader Joe’s Green Goddess Seasoning, like most dried herbs and spices, does not truly “expire” in the sense of becoming unsafe to eat. However, its flavor and potency will diminish over time. The “best by” date on the packaging typically indicates the period during which the seasoning is expected to retain its optimal quality.
While the seasoning may still be usable after the “best by” date, its flavor might be less intense. It’s generally recommended to use the seasoning within 12-18 months of purchase for the best flavor. Always use your senses – if the seasoning looks discolored or smells stale, it’s likely lost its flavor and should be replaced.
